iCAx开思工具箱
标题:
特征识别
[打印本页]
作者:
zzrxt
时间:
2008-12-13 16:39
标题:
特征识别
如图所示:
我需要通过选取绿色面,得到所有红色面的TAG,如果有做过这方面研究的同行还请多指点。
讨论1:通过API遍历所有面,找与绿色面有某种内在联系的面??
讨论2:kf是否能比较方便的识别出此类面??
讨论3:能否查找到与封闭的边界(紫色)??
作者:
zzrxt
时间:
2008-12-14 09:30
顶起
作者:
zsf830
时间:
2008-12-14 17:20
顶起
作者:
sac807
时间:
2008-12-15 10:48
手工选中绿色面的,这时候可以问出它所在的实体Solid。
UF_MODL_ask_face_body
然后再通过问出这个体上所有面的TAG,再把绿色面排除。
UF_MODL_ask_body_faces
不知这一思路可否。
作者:
zzrxt
时间:
2008-12-15 18:45
谢谢兄弟,不过还是无法达到我的要求的,如果body很大,有许多小面,这样的方法肯定要很长时间。如果能自动找到红色面区域的边界也不错。。。
作者:
vkmold
时间:
2008-12-16 13:01
通过1个种子面,把相邻的面也自动高亮显示,首先要面面共边,再计算面面法向之间的夹角,邻面之间的夹角IF>180则排除,通过这个方法可以自动选取区域面
但要得到区域面的边界,似乎在思路上要有突破,我也没有想到方法,期待高手出现,帮顶一下
作者:
sac807
时间:
2008-12-16 13:11
1. 选择绿色面。
2.求出绿色面的边界。
3.求出共享这些边界面的集合。
这样可以吗?
作者:
guangping
时间:
2008-12-16 13:49
这应该是一个特征面吧?应该是型腔特征,可以遍历特征树,找到包含此面的特征即可
作者:
cam-yp
时间:
2008-12-16 16:25
如果是非参数的呢?
作者:
zzrxt
时间:
2008-12-16 18:55
呵呵,谢谢各位的意见,如果遍历面的话我想应该是可以实现的,就像上面几位兄弟说的,有没有人用过KF呢,看ugs的介绍好像挺不错的,可以对非参模型进行特征识别,不知道具体能达到什么境界呢?其实我需要的是一种简单,又能通用的方法而已。谢谢朋友们,希望能有更多的朋友说说您的做法。。。。
作者:
zzrxt
时间:
2008-12-18 21:11
找了好久这方面的资料,像模像样的真的没有,难道特征识别这项技术仅仅停留在实验室的阶段?也许离模具业的使用要求还有一段距离?看到浙大的验收报告,又让我有了这方面的希望,真希望能看看他们的成果,是否可用于模具业,看起来好像挺不错的。
作者:
cam-yp
时间:
2008-12-19 08:27
可以成功是肯定的,NX自带的电极模块听说就是华中科技大学开发的,里面就有类似特征识别的功能,
作者:
zzrxt
时间:
2008-12-19 18:55
是的,好像是这么说,杨兄,有没有做过这方面的尝试?
作者:
cam-yp
时间:
2008-12-20 08:30
还没有,我只是业余弄弄,不专业
作者:
zenghong789
时间:
2008-12-25 21:20
顶一下。路过的
欢迎光临 iCAx开思工具箱 (https://t.icax.org/)
Powered by Discuz! X3.3